The St. George Church is the Protestant church in the village of Gimritz in Saxony-Anhalt , which is part of the Wettin-Löbejün community .

The church is located on a hill in the village. It belongs to the parish Wettin in the parish of Halle-Saale district of the Evangelical Church in Central Germany .

Who is also dedicated to St. The predecessor building of today's church, consecrated to George, was built between 1483 and 1493 in an old hill fort north of the village, made of stones from the abandoned Müelte Monastery . It may also have had a previous building.

The hall church was built in 1847 from rubble stones in the neo-Romanesque style. The design came from the construction manager Schulze and was made in 1843 and revised by the government master builder Friedrich August Ritter . The church is similar to the Rothenburg village church built in 1844 . To the west of the nave is the church tower with a square floor plan. A semicircular apse is added to the east side of the nave .

Inside the church there is a horseshoe gallery from the second half of the 19th century. The interior of the church was painted in 1926 by the Halle artist Karl Völker . In the apse there is a depiction of Christ as the Good Shepherd. An altar shrine with carved figures dates back to around 1500. The figures, which were only put together later, show John the Evangelist and Saint Jerome. A wooden crucifix dates back to the 15th century . The ends of the cross arms are square and have incised symbols of evangelists. These older pieces of equipment come from the previous building.

The pulpit and baptismal font of the church date from the second half of the 19th century. An organ from the time the church was built was repaired in 1950, but later destroyed by vandalism during the GDR era . In 2003 the church received a new organ.

In the register of monuments of the municipality Wettin-Löbejün the church is registered as an architectural monument under registration number 094 55122.
